Belfast Giants’ Christmas video is YouTube smash – SEE VIDEO

Ice hockey team sing to promote upcoming games


The Elite Ice Hockey League team, the Belfast Giants, have made a music video for Christmas of Mariah Carey’s “All I want for Christmas”.
 
The video which show the team busting some serious moves while lip-syncing along to the Christmas hit has already generated almost 30,000 viewers.
 
It seems that the video went viral after it was mentioned on Twitter by Mariah Carey. She tweeted “The Belfast Giants show off some festive moves in their video version of All I Want For Christmas Is You.”
 
Manager of the Giants, Todd Kelman, said he came up with this idea as a way to promote upcoming games.
 
He said “It had been a slow week for us with just one game so I thought it would be a bit of fun for us to get together and make this video of the guys lip-syncing to Mariah Carey…We got Debbie Maguire, our cheerleaders’ coach, to choreograph the routine and then the guys who do our videos shot it.
 
“Some of the Giants had never danced before and I think Debbie was a bit shocked at how uncoordinated they were. But after a few hours practice they looked pretty convincing.”
 
Todd believes he’s spotted a couple of stars in the team. He said “Craig Peacock is pretty good in it…But I’d have to single out Mike Hoffman in his elf costume. It’s not every day you get to see a 6ft 5in man dressed as a Christmas elf.”
